Responsibilities
• Prepare cost estimates and cost plans, incorporating benchmarking data for review.
• Develop value engineering and life cycle costing options to optimize project efficiency.
• Identify potential risks and help maintain the project’s Risk Register.
• Contribute to pre-contract process meetings, offering cost-related insights.
• Create and manage cost control reports to track financial performance.
• Attend client meetings with senior colleagues and document key discussion points and actions.
• Participate in design team meetings, assess cost implications, and implement agreed outcomes.
• Prepare and manage change order logs, invoice logs, and detailed cost reports.
• Oversee measurements and pricing research for development appraisals and qualification reviews.

Requirements
• Bachelor's degree or equivalent - in Quantity Surveying, Construction Management, Data Analytics or another cost / construction focused specialism
• 2+ years of minimum cost management experience
• Proficient in MS Office 365

Nice-to-haves
• Post contract administration skills
• Experience in Mission Critical projects
• Project close-out skills
